      For a gaming teenager from the Web 1.0 era, the PC Gamer CDs were legitimately hot ticket items. You'd keep every single CD and play every single demo, and if you got a good one, you'd play it 900 times, because the selection of games wasn't all that great and a $40 game was much more expensive then than a $60 is today... plus you had to get a ride to the store and buy a physical copy (which might or might not install or work properly on your system). I remember being crushed when I saved up for the first Rainbow Six without considering my puny onboard 2D/3D chip... that game sat in the jewel case for almost a year before I could spring for a Voodoo(2? 3?). Demos were like instant gratification and free as a bird on your doorstep every month.
      I always thought it was strange that demos died just as pay-per-minute dial up was dying and DSL and cable internet were becoming prevalent. I assumed at the time that it would result in MORE demand for demos when people could download them for free in minutes instead of hours. Instead, the companies seemed to realize demos were more expensive than simply making a bunch of hype videos with pre-rendered gameplay and pushing THOSE using high-bandwidth web, and so they all went poof and nobody complained.

    Comic store employee here; what we did when we were boarding and bagging comics is bag the boards first then slide the comics in after. They do make Ashcan bags which could fit cdroms like you have there if you wanted to bag the cdroms then slip them in the other bag. You'd do that for longtime storage in case they would stick together, sometimes the print would bleed and get sticky over long time of storage.
